Bharti AXA Life Insurance Wins Great Manager Awards

Mumbai, Maharashtra, India | 3rd December 2019: Bharti AXA Life Insurance, a joint venture between Bharti Enterprises, one of India’s leading business groups, and AXA, one of the world’s largest insurance companies, has been conferred with the ‘Companies with Great Managers Award’ for demonstrating and fostering managerial excellence in the company.

The prestigious recognition was bestowed upon Bharti AXA Life Insurance at the 4th edition of the Great Manager Awards 2019, a People Business initiative which identifies, recognizes and rewards organisations with great managers, here recently.

The company has secured a place in the list of top 20 companies with great managers for promoting managerial brilliance in the business of people and change management.

Bharti AXA Life Insurance also bagged two awards in ‘Hunt for Great Managers’ category for individual managerial distinction. The two leaders also figured into the list of top 51 managers in India.

The Great Manager Awards, which enables participant organizations to compare and benchmark themselves and their managers across the industry, witnessed participation of over 5,000 managers from different organizations. Among them, 51 were adjudged as “Great Managers” after a stringent process of assessment and interviews by industry experts.

As many as 120 companies participated in the contest for ‘‘Companies with Great Managers’’ and 20 companies made it to the final list.

Bharti AXA Life Insurance is among the fastest growing life insurance companies and provides its employees with opportunities to learn and grow. It has more than 5,000 employees across India and over 40,000 insurance advisors to drive its growth journey.
